Mastering Micro-Interaction Triggers: Precise Techniques for Responsive User Engagement – Online Reviews | Donor Approved | Nonprofit Review Sites

Hacklink panel

Hacklink Panel

Hacklink panel

Hacklink

Hacklink panel

Backlink paketleri

Hacklink Panel

Hacklink

Hacklink

Hacklink

Hacklink panel

Hacklink

Hacklink

Hacklink

Hacklink

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ink satın al

Hacklink satın al

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Illuminati

Hacklink

Hacklink Panel

Hacklink

Hacklink Panel

Hacklink panel

Hacklink Panel

Hacklink

Masal oku

Hacklink

Hacklink

Hacklink

Hacklink

Hacklink

Hacklink

Hacklink

Hacklink panel

Postegro

Masal Oku

Hacklink

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ink

Hacklink

Hacklink

Hacklink

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ink

Hacklink

Hacklink Panel

Hacklink

Hacklink

Hacklink

Buy Hacklink

Hacklink

Hacklink

Hacklink

Hacklink

Hacklink satın al

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ink panel

Hacklink

Masal Oku

Hacklink panel

Hacklink

Hacklink

Hacklink

Hacklink satın al

Hacklink Panel

Eros Maç Tv

หวยออนไลน์

kavbet

pulibet güncel giriş

pulibet giriş

casibom

harbiwin

efsino

casibom

casibom

serdivan escort

antalya dedektör

holiganbet

holiganbet giriş

casibom

casibom

sapanca escort

deneme bonusu veren siteler

fixbet giriş

milosbet

mislibet giriş

mislibet

parmabet

kingroyal

kingroyal güncel giriş

kingroyal giriş

kingroyal giriş

jojobet

jojobet giriş

Grandpashabet

interbahis

taraftarium24

norabahis giriş

casibom

izmir escort

jojobet giriş

kingroyal

eyfelcasino

casibom

ultrabet

betnano

betnano

betnano

ultrabet

İkimisli

betnano

kingroyal

kingroyal giriş

kingroyal güncel giriş

cratoscasino

cratos casino

kingroyal

kingroyal giriş

kingroyal güncel giriş

king royal giriş

king royal

porno

deneme bonusu veren siteler

sakarya escort

Mastering Micro-Interaction Triggers: Precise Techniques for Responsive User Engagement

Designing effective micro-interactions hinges critically on how well you implement trigger mechanisms that respond accurately to user behavior. This deep dive explores actionable, expert-level techniques to craft context-aware triggers, optimize timing, and set up conditional responses that feel natural and enhance overall user engagement. Building on the broader understanding of micro-interactions as discussed in “How to Design Effective Micro-Interactions to Enhance User Engagement”, this guide provides concrete steps to elevate trigger precision and responsiveness.

1. Implementing Context-Aware Triggers

a) Leveraging User Environment and State

Effective triggers are not static; they adapt based on user context. First, analyze the environment — device type, screen size, input method — and the user state, such as scroll position, previous interactions, or session duration. For instance, a mobile app might trigger a tooltip on a long press only if the user hasn’t interacted with the element before, preventing redundant prompts.

b) Using Data-Driven Event Listeners

Set up event listeners that are conditional on real-time data. For example, in JavaScript:

  
  if (userHasSeenTutorial) {
      element.removeEventListener('click', showTutorial);
  } else {
      element.addEventListener('click', showTutorial);
  }
  
  

c) Practical Application: Adaptive Micro-Interactions

Build a system where triggers adapt after initial user interaction. For example, after a user dismisses a modal once, subsequent triggers are suppressed or replaced with less intrusive variants, reducing frustration and over-interaction.

2. Timing and Delay Optimization

a) Fine-Tuning Response Latency

The perceived responsiveness depends on how quickly the micro-interaction responds. Use high-resolution timers (e.g., performance.now() in JavaScript) to measure actual delays and adjust them to be within 100-200ms for critical responses, ensuring they feel instantaneous.

b) Implementing Delays to Prevent Accidental Triggers

Introduce slight delays for gesture-based triggers to differentiate intentional actions from accidental ones. For example, require a press-and-hold for at least 500ms before activating a special menu, avoiding accidental activation during quick taps.

c) Using Debounce and Throttle Techniques

Prevent rapid, repeated triggers that can overwhelm the UI or frustrate users. For example, debounce a search input to trigger only after 300ms of inactivity, or throttle a button activation to once every second.

3. Setting Up Conditional Triggers Based on User Behavior

a) Combining Multiple Conditions

Use logical operators to create complex trigger conditions. For example, only show a tooltip if the user hovers over an element and has scrolled beyond a certain point:

  
  if (hovered && scrollY > 300) {
      showTooltip();
  }
  
  

b) Contextual Triggers Based on User Path

Analyze user navigation paths to trigger micro-interactions only when relevant. For instance, trigger a product recommendation prompt only after the user has viewed several related items, not immediately on page load.

c) Implementing State-Dependent Triggers

Use internal state machines to manage trigger conditions. For example, enable a “Save” button only when form validation passes and the user has made changes, preventing premature or unnecessary triggers.

Summary of Actionable Steps and Best Practices

Step Action Tip
Identify User Context Analyze environment, device, and user state Use analytics tools and session recordings
Set Conditional Event Listeners Implement in JavaScript with dynamic conditions Avoid hardcoded triggers to maintain flexibility
Optimize Timing Use performance.now() and debounce/throttle Ensure responses feel instant and natural
Combine Multiple Conditions Use logical operators to refine triggers Prevent irrelevant or premature micro-interactions

By meticulously crafting trigger mechanisms with these advanced techniques, UX designers and developers can create micro-interactions that not only feel intuitive but also adapt dynamically to user behavior. This level of precision reduces user frustration, increases engagement, and aligns micro-animations with broader usability goals. Remember, the key lies in understanding the subtle nuances of user context and implementing conditional, timing-sensitive triggers that respond seamlessly, fostering a frictionless experience that users appreciate and trust.

For further insights on integrating micro-interactions into your overall UX strategy and ensuring consistency across platforms, explore {tier1_anchor}.

Leave a Reply